Germano Cavalcante 19fee82b72 Fix #131236: 'batch_for_shader' not working with POLYLINE shaders
In Blender 4.4 (since commit 00a8d006fe), polyline shaders stopped
using geometry shaders and now rely on SSBOs.

In C++, workarounds allow these shaders to function as before, albeit
with some limitations.

However, this change broke the `batch_for_shader` function in Python,
as `GPUShader.attrs_info_get()` only reads attributes and does not
support SSBOs.

To address this, the method now treats polyline shaders differently,
accessing SSBO inputs instead of attributes.

/* SPDX-FileCopyrightText: 2023 Blender Authors
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later */
/** \file
* \ingroup bpygpu
*/
#pragma once
#ifndef __cplusplus
# include "../generic/py_capi_utils.hh"
#endif
struct GPUShaderCreateInfo;
struct GPUStageInterfaceInfo;
/* Make sure that there is always a reference count for PyObjects of type String as the strings are
* passed by reference in the #GPUStageInterfaceInfo and #GPUShaderCreateInfo APIs. */
#define USE_GPU_PY_REFERENCES
/* `gpu_py_shader.cc` */
extern PyTypeObject BPyGPUShader_Type;
#define BPyGPUShader_Check(v) (Py_TYPE(v) == &BPyGPUShader_Type)
typedef struct BPyGPUShader {
PyObject_VAR_HEAD
struct GPUShader *shader;
bool is_builtin;
} BPyGPUShader;
PyObject *BPyGPUShader_CreatePyObject(struct GPUShader *shader, bool is_builtin);
PyObject *bpygpu_shader_init(void);
/* gpu_py_shader_create_info.cc */
extern const struct PyC_StringEnumItems pygpu_attrtype_items[];
extern PyTypeObject BPyGPUShaderCreateInfo_Type;
extern PyTypeObject BPyGPUStageInterfaceInfo_Type;
#define BPyGPUShaderCreateInfo_Check(v) (Py_TYPE(v) == &BPyGPUShaderCreateInfo_Type)
#define BPyGPUStageInterfaceInfo_Check(v) (Py_TYPE(v) == &BPyGPUStageInterfaceInfo_Type)
struct BPyGPUStageInterfaceInfo {
PyObject_VAR_HEAD
GPUStageInterfaceInfo *interface;
#ifdef USE_GPU_PY_REFERENCES
/* Just to keep a user to prevent freeing buffers we're using. */
PyObject *references;
#endif
};
struct BPyGPUShaderCreateInfo {
PyObject_VAR_HEAD
GPUShaderCreateInfo *info;
#ifdef USE_GPU_PY_REFERENCES
/* Just to keep a user to prevent freeing buffers we're using. */
PyObject *vertex_source;
PyObject *fragment_source;
PyObject *compute_source;
PyObject *typedef_source;
PyObject *references;
#endif
size_t constants_total_size;
};
PyObject *BPyGPUStageInterfaceInfo_CreatePyObject(GPUStageInterfaceInfo *interface);
PyObject *BPyGPUShaderCreateInfo_CreatePyObject(GPUShaderCreateInfo *info);
bool bpygpu_shader_is_polyline(GPUShader *shader);
